Citing the Rising Influence and Power of Women, 2 Anthropologists Ponder the Future of Men
Colleagues at Rutgers U. offer differing perspectives in books released last week
To many scholars, the flood of women into the labor force during the latter half of this century has been an unusual event in civilization, one made possible by gains in the women's movement and by an increasingly competitive, materialistic, and technologically oriented society.
